Customs Intelligence Deputy Director Anwar forms teams to check sale of smuggled items

bySaleem Awan Sheikhu
10/03/2016
in Latest News, National
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

SIALKOT: Custom Intelligence and Intelligence, Gujranwala, Deputy Director Muhammad Anwar has formed teams to check shops and markets to trace the persons involved in selling of smuggled goods.

Officials said that the deputy director took this step after getting information regarding the selling of non-duty paid items in local markets depriving the country of revenue. The teams will check the shops and markets to detect the selling of imported items, including cigarettes, juice, etc.

If shopkeepers found involved in this crime, they will be arrested, besides sealing their shops, they said adding that Customs Intelligence will take stern action against them to discourage the smuggling.

The official said that Customs Intelligence staff has also been deputed on GT road to check the suspect vehicles, which were used to smuggle the non-duty paid items.
